Printing Issues with with image layers
After we fixed the MS's security update issue with the printing, we added two aerial image layers. They appear fine on the map.
However, when we try to print the map with newly added image layers, the pdf map doesn't print the newly added image layers only. They are 2017 aerial images in 4 & 9 inch., cached and serviced from our own rest service. When I print the maps with existing image layers it prints fine. But it doesn't include newly added 2017 images only. I checked site.xml document to see if there is any difference in settings between 2017 & existing aerial images. But the settings were the same.
Any thoughts or comments will be very helpful. We are using GE 4.5.1 and GVH 2.6.1

Hi Howard,
If I look at the export request from the viewer I see it asking for the layer -
{ "id": "70", "title": "70", "opacity": 1, "minScale": 900000, "maxScale": 500, "url": "http:\/\/apps.willcogis.org\/arcgis\/rest\/services\/OrthoImagery\/Orthos_2017_4IN_P\/MapServer", "visibility": true },
so the next step would be to set up Fiddler on the server and view the request Essentials is sending to the map service and to see what is being returned.
I would recommend submitting a support request for this unless you are really familiar with Fiddler. We do have a KBA on it -
